Delft Centre for Sustainable Urban Areas

Neighbourhoods are being transformed. Urban networks are being created. The built environment must cater to the varied demands of humans and the environment both now and in the future. Integrated knowledge of the development of urban areas helps to create a place worth living in.
In an urbanizing world, the challenge is to ensure that this process does not endanger the quality of life, economic vitality, social cohesion and mobility of our environment. We therefore have to create the right conditions for the future and plan sustainable urban areas where people can live, work and entertain themselves. This calls for multidisciplinary research along the lines of the work carried out by the Delft Centre for Sustainable Urban Areas. It is here that we learn to understand things like the housing market, planning policy, neighbourhood development, business activity in urban areas and leisure development: factors that will lead to the practical and sustainable renewal of our built environment.
